Output 3c590ce8d4db9f8ddb51231b4748bc18f5b4e01ca54a15fed6d07f395e62bcc4:1

value
96941559
script pubkey
OP_0 OP_PUSHBYTES_20 3993277e5cf874a1aae770a19a67468e002e6040
address
tb1q8xfjwljulp62r2h8wzse5e6x3cqzuczq6kvfpw
transaction
3c590ce8d4db9f8ddb51231b4748bc18f5b4e01ca54a15fed6d07f395e62bcc4
confirmations
118817
spent
true